Jersey Chamber Orchestra

Established by Music in Action in October 2008, the Jersey Chamber Orchestra performs at least three concerts each year.  The premise is to perform technically challenging and exciting programmes not otherwise heard in Jersey. 

The orchestra is led by Anna Smith who plays with the BBC Symphony Orchestra.  

The orchestra is made up of a mixture of local artists and overseas professionals. Bursary places are offered for up to 4 young musicians to perform in each concert.

The orchestra has performed with many established soloists including Sir James Galway, Nicola Benedetti, Leonard Elschenbroich, Alexander Sitkovetsky, Lawrence Power, Alison Balsom.  It has also worked with such singers as Elizabeth Watts, Sophie Bevan, Lawrence Zazzo, Victoria Simmonds and Kate Royal.
